293 - INFORMATION AND PRIVACY - PROTECTION OF PRIVACY
•Records relating to the collection, use, disclosure, and protection of
personal information as regulated under section 26 to 34 of the Freedom of
Information and Protection of Privacy Act (FOIPPA) (RSBC 1996, c. 165). This
primary also relates to the identification and description of personal
information banks, the correction of personal information, and the notification
of correction of personal information. In addition this primary covers the
development of privacy impact assessments, as required under section 69(5) of
the FOIPPA
•Record types include: correspondence, memoranda, and reports.

| 293-50 |
Protection of privacy issues
(arrange alphabetically by issue)
SO = when issue has been resolved, the information is
no longer current, and/or the information is no longer required for reference purposes
SR = The government archives will retain protection of
privacy issue case files which document the identification and resolution of significant
issues over time. Files kept purely for reference purposes (that is, convenience
copies of issues dealt with by other jurisdictions) should be removed and destroyed, upon
authorization of the Records Officer, when files are being boxed for transfer to off-site
storage. |

| •293-60 |
Privacy impact assessments
(also known as PIAs)
(arrange by PIA number)
SO = upon disposition of records covered by the PIA or completion of a new PIA
NOTE = Privacy impact assessments are conducted to determine if new legislation, systems,
projects, or programs meet the requirements of part 3 of the Act.
